A number of studies have shown that lottery gambling is associated with a higher level of substance use. While it is not clear that lottery gambling causes alcohol or other substance abuse, it may contribute to it.

Proponents of lottery gaming argue that they provide a way to increase state revenues while avoiding additional taxes. They also believe that the games are a cost-effective way to attract new people to a community, especially young people.

They can also raise awareness and support for important social issues. For example, they are often used to fund school programs, public works projects and charitable activities.

Some of the most popular American lottery games include Powerball, Mega Millions and Lotto America. These games are run by multiple states and have enormous jackpots that can reach billions of dollars.

In addition to these large-scale lottery games, there are also smaller, more affordable and more frequent lotteries. For example, there are daily and weekly scratch-offs that can be played for a small amount of money.
